Question
what is the name of the ligament that extends from the styloid process to the posterior margin of the angle of the mandibular ramus? sphenomandibular ligament coracoclavicular ligament stylomandibular ligament glenohumeral ligament i dont know yet
Brief Explanations
The stylomandibular ligament extends from the styloid process to the posterior margin of the angle of the mandibular ramus. It is an anatomical structure related to the mandible.
